θεότης G2320
Pronunciation theótēs

What does θεότης (theótēs) mean in the Bible?

θεότης (theótēs): Abstract divine nature or essence itself, distinct from visible manifestations of God's attributes

How does the BSB render G2320?

The BSB source-word alignment has 1 aligned row for this entry. Common renderings include Deity (1).

Where does θεότης (theótēs) appear in Scripture?

The source-word alignment first shows this entry at Colossians 2:9. Its strongest book concentrations include Colossians (1).
